What is Lost Odyssey?

Lost Odyssey was a popular Role-Playing game that was released in 2007 . It was a game loved by thousands in it’s community who seemingly played it all day, everyday! The game was created by the company Microsoft Game Studios and was played on the Xbox 360.

Name Lost Odyssey
Platform Xbox 360
Year 2007
Genre Role-Playing
Publisher Microsoft Game Studios
Sales in North America 450,000
Sales in Europe 270,000
Sales in Japan 110,000
Sales in the rest of the world 90,000
Total Global Sales 920,000
